1. Molecular recognition of proteins by functionalized folded polypeptide receptors
Sammanfattning : This thesis describes the design, synthesis and characterization of synthetic receptor molecules for the recognition and binding of proteins with applications in bioseparation and biosensing. A 42-residue polypeptide, designed to fold into a helix-loop-helix motif and dimerize in solution to form a four-helix bundle, was used as the scaffold. LÄS MER

3. The EGF-like Modules of Anticoagulant Protein S. Studies of Ca2+ binding and module interactions
Sammanfattning : Protein S functions as a cofactor to activated protein C (APC) in the degradation of factors Va and VIIIa. In plasma protein S circulates in two forms; 30-40 % circulates as free protein S molecules while the remaining 60-70 % exists in a 1:1 complex with C4b-binding protein (C4BP). Only the free form of protein S functions as a cofactor to APC. LÄS MER
